Thanks to their smooth, soft lines, elegant and solemn appearance, French curtains are in demand in any interior and are considered the most successful option for decoration in the classicism or baroque style.

French curtains are a canvas consisting of many horizontal folds cascading from top to bottom, between vertical scallops.

French curtains are lifting types of curtains. Without moving to the sides, they rise and form folds and waves, giving the composition splendor, volume, and integrity. These curtains differ from the Austrian ones in that the French ones have waves all over the canvas, while the Austrian curtains have waves only at the bottom.

Kinds

French curtains, based on the general principles of their design, vary in length: it can be maximum, medium and short.

By design they are distinguished:

  • Static curtains.
  • Lifting curtains.

The static view is more often used in rooms where there is no need to open the window space.

Lifting curtains, due to their wider decorative possibilities and functionality, are used more often. They can be supplemented with a lock to adjust the length of the fabric and the number of folds. With its help you can turn a curtain into a lush lambrequin.

The appearance of the folds depends on the choice of material:

  • The heavier and softer the fabric, the smoother the folds will be.
  • The lighter and stiffer the material, the more magnificent the composition.

The volume of the structure as a whole is influenced by the degree of contraction of the canvas and the distance between the vertical lines. For splendor, special fabric impregnations are also used.

Curtains made from plain fabrics in pastel or muted tones look impressive. The choice of pattern should be approached very carefully, since it can get lost in the drapery and look completely different from what was expected.

The amount of material for French curtains is calculated according to the length of the cornice, with allowance for seams, and the length is calculated to be 1.5 - 2.5 times the height from the cornice to the floor.

Cornices

Static curtains can be hung on curtain rods of any traditional or modern design:

  • Round (bar).
  • Strings.
  • Baguettes.
  • Rail.

For mounting on a cornice, fixtures for ordinary curtains are required:

  • Hooks.
  • Clamps.
  • Rings.
  • Special curtain tape.

Lifting curtains require a profile metal-plastic cornice with a lifting mechanism (more about curtain rods). The finished product is attached to the cornice using adhesive tape, which is sewn along the upper edge of the fabric, and glued or stapled to the profile. Roller blinds are operated either manually or electrically.

For home use, it is better to use a curtain rod with a manual lifting mechanism, as it is simple and reliable to use.

There are two types of lifting mechanisms:

  • Open type (located under the profile).
  • Closed type (located inside the profile).

In public institutions where large, heavy curtains are used: restaurants, concert halls, theaters, an automatic or remote control mechanism is used to withstand the weight of the curtains.

Roman and roller blinds

Roman and roller blinds, proposed above as a universal option for the kitchen, are also successfully used in living rooms, only the type of fabric used and the size of the canvases differ.

Such curtains will be a lifeline in a small living room. Laconic canvases placed tightly to the window frame will not take up precious centimeters. Roller blinds and Roman blinds will fit organically into the interiors of living rooms decorated in modern and minimalist styles.

Japanese curtains

And since we are talking about minimalism, Japanese curtains come to the fore. An entire system of screens mounted on a multi-row cornice allows the fabric panels to move parallel to each other. Curtains that do not have folds can serve as a real art object that attracts the attention of guests due to the large pattern on the canvases.

Classic curtain design

Classic curtains include long, wide curtains that fall to the floor. The fabric, intercepted by beautiful tiebacks, forms chic folds, giving the curtains a more sophisticated look.


English curtains

English curtains can be either an independent element decorating a window or an alternative to regular tulle. They can be distinguished by the rounded folds of the lower part of the translucent fabric.

Austrian curtains

Austrian curtains look great as an independent element of decor, although they do not go against the company of curtains. The lower part is reminiscent of English curtains, but the Austrian curtains are lifted with a slight movement, showing lush, rounded festoons. When assembled, Austrian curtains look more impressive, showing off luxurious tails. They are appropriate in rooms that gravitate towards Baroque, Art Deco and, of course, classic styles.

French style curtain design

French curtains, unknowingly, can be confused with Austrian curtains and vice versa. There are actually many differences; the French ones are made from expensive thin fabrics, and when unfolded they look like a lot of festoons, gathered into identical tails along the entire length of the fabric. The curtains look equally impressive both folded and unfolded. Chic curtains of an interesting shape, a lambrequin will be an excellent addition to French curtains and will complete the look of the living room, filling it with the exquisite luxury of a classic interior.

The French nation experienced a similar transition from despondency to dreamy despair at the turn of the 17th and 18th centuries. The middle class became disillusioned with revolutionary ideals. To fill the resulting spiritual void, he took up general education and adopted an aristocratic attitude to life. Thus was born one of the most poetic styles in art - romance. It synthesizes all previous trends: Empire, Rococo, Baroque. Much attention is paid to pastoral themes and idealized folklore motifs.

This style is characterized by sophistication, elegance, sophistication, smooth lines, and calm colors. The interior is based on a variety of lightweight fabrics. Romantic style curtains frame window and door openings, soft textiles hang like canopies, drape tables and beds, flow from ceiling beams and baguettes. Long tablecloths, embroidered pillows, comfortable cushions, multi-layered romantic style curtains created from silk, cotton, finest linen, taffeta.
